Campbell, CA
Campbell is a city in Santa Clara County, California, in the San Francisco Bay Area. As of the 2020 U.S. Census, Campbell's population is 43,959. Campbell is home to the Pruneyard Shopping Center, a sprawling open-air retail complex that was involved in a famous U.S. Supreme Court case that established the extent of the right to free speech in California.
Today, the Pruneyard Shopping Center is home to the South Bay offices of the Federal Bureau of Investigation.
Campbell is bordered on the east and north by San Jose, on the south by Los Gatos, and the west by a small portion of Saratoga. According to the United States Census Bureau, the city has a total area of 5.9 square miles (15 km2), of which 5.8 square miles (15 km2) is land and 0.1 square miles (0.26 km2) is water.
Of the total area, 1.49% is water, consisting of percolation ponds in Los Gatos Creek Park and in other locations; San Tomas Aquino Creek, which flows north on the west side of the city, is completely enclosed with fences and runs through concrete culverts; and Los Gatos Creek, which flows north-north-east on the east side of the city and has paths along both banks for hikers and joggers (locally called the "Perc Ponds"). Residents can reach Los Gatos by continuing on the creek trail. Downtown Campbell contains many local stores and shops, and every Sunday the downtown street closes from 8 am-1 pm for a local farmers market.
State Route 17 runs roughly parallel to Los Gatos Creek on its eastern side; State Route 85 runs roughly east-west through Los Gatos just south of Campbell and cuts through the southwest corner of the city.
Before the founding of the neighborhood of Campbell, the land was occupied by the Ohlone, the Native American people of the Northern California coast. About a third of present-day Campbell was part of the 1839 Alta California Rancho Rinconada de Los Gatos land grant. The northern extent of the grant land was along present-day Rincon Avenue and across the North end of John D. Morgan Park in central Campbell.

What is Campbell, CA Known For?
Campbell was first known for its churches, which once directed community life. Later, the Board of Trade became the leading community service. The Board of Trade is now known as the Campbell Chamber of Commerce.
What is the History of Campbell, CA?
The city of Campbell was founded by a true pioneer, Benjamin Campbell, who arrived in 1846. The historic heart of the city is located on the original 160-acre ranch property which he purchased in 1851. Benjamin started his farming career by planting hay and grain. Later, he and his wife, Mary Rucker Campbell, subdivided acreage to create a town and railroad station stop in 1887.
